NVIDIA GeForce RTX 3060 vs NVIDIA GeForce RTX 3080 Ti

We compared two Desktop platform GPUs: 12GB VRAM GeForce RTX 3060 and 12GB VRAM GeForce RTX 3080 Ti to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ce RTX 3060 's Advantages
Boost Clock has increased by 7% (1777MHz vs 1665MHz)
Lower TDP (170W vs 350W)
NVIDIA GeForce RTX 3080 Ti 's Advantages
Larger VRAM bandwidth (912.4GB/s vs 360.0GB/s)
6656 additional rendering cores
